Sanna Oikari is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cell Biology and Cancer Research. According to data from OpenAlex, Sanna Oikari has authored 44 papers receiving a total of 1.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 33 papers in Molecular Biology, 23 papers in Cell Biology and 10 papers in Cancer Research. Recurrent topics in Sanna Oikari’s work include Proteoglycans and glycosaminoglycans research (23 papers), Glycosylation and Glycoproteins Research (15 papers) and Extracellular vesicles in disease (10 papers). Sanna Oikari is often cited by papers focused on Proteoglycans and glycosaminoglycans research (23 papers), Glycosylation and Glycoproteins Research (15 papers) and Extracellular vesicles in disease (10 papers). Sanna Oikari collaborates with scholars based in Finland, Italy and United States. Sanna Oikari's co-authors include Kirsi Rilla, Markku Tammi, Raija Tammi, Riikka Kärnä, Päivi Auvinen, Sanna Pasonen‐Seppänen, Satu Tiainen, Kirsi Hämäläinen, Tiina Jokela and Ashik Jawahar Deen and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Cancer Research and Biochemical Journal.
